Obama Aides Head to Cambridge

There's a two-way street between Harvard and the Obama Administration. Ever since President Obama's election in 2008, droves of Harvard professors and graduates have left New England for the White House. But this fall, a myriad of junior-level White House staffers are migrating to Cambridge to pursue degrees across the University.
